GitLab如何进行代码审查 2024-04-03 375 GitLab通过提供一套综合性的功能,让代码审查变得高效和系统化。这些功能主要包括合并请求(Merge Requests)、内联评论(Inline comments)、代码审查指南、代码审查报告等。在 …
GitLab Pages部署个人网站步骤 2024-04-03 299 GitLab Pages允许用户使用GitLab仓库来部署个人网站,主要步骤包括:设置项目、配置文件、编写网页内容、使用CI/CD进行自动部署。通过GitLab的CI/CD功能,可以自动从仓库构建、测 …
如何恢复GitLab中的删除分支 2024-04-03 1179 GitLab中的删除分支可以通过几种方式恢复,包括通过Git的引用日志(reflog)、使用GitLab中的备份或者通过重新创建分支并回滚到删除前的提交。其中,使用Git的引用日志是最直接和最常用的方 …
GitLab与GitHub有什么区别 2024-04-03 363 GitLab与GitHub是当前最流行的代码托管和版本控制平台,它们都为软件开发提供了极其关键的支持。二者主要的区别在于:所有权模式、集成CI/CD工具、自托管能力、以及社区支持。较之GitHub,G …
在GitLab中如何创建新项目 2024-04-03 522 在GitLab中创建新项目是一个简单且基础的操作,关键步骤包括选择项目位置、填写项目详情、设置项目可见性和导入项目资源。选择项目位置是首要步骤之一,涉及到将项目托管在个人账户下还是组织账户下,这直接关 …
GitLab CI/CD的执行器配置指南 2024-04-03 169 GitLab CI/CD的执行器是指在为项目提供持续集成和部署时承担任务执行的组件。配置GitLab执行器的关键步骤包括选择合适的执行器类型、安装相关软件、设置配置文件以及注册执行器到GitLab实例 …
如何在GitLab上导入GitHub项目 2024-04-03 478 要在GitLab上导入GitHub项目,您可以首先在GitLab创建一个新项目、选择从GitHub导入、将GitHub仓库链接到GitLab、然后执行导入操作。这个过程要求您有GitLab和GitHu …
GitLab如何配置CI/CD流程 2024-04-03 209 GitLab的CI/CD(持续集成/持续部署)流程配置起来既直观又高效,实质上需要创建一个.yaml格式的文件、定义多个阶段、编写作业清单、以及设置环境和变量。文件名通常为.gitlab-ci.yml …
policycoreutils 这个依赖是干嘛用的 2024-04-03 190 Policycoreutils 是一组管理和查询SELinux策略的核心实用程序集。它们提供了执行策略管理任务所需的命令行工具,包括加载策略、管理布尔值和策略模块、以及支持日常管理员任务。Policy …
为什么 IT 项目总会出现延期 2024-04-03 115 项目需求不明确、资源分配不合理、技术难题未预见、团队协作不畅以及项目管理不到位等因素,常导致IT项目延期。其中,项目需求不明确是导致项目延误的主要原因。在项目启动阶段,若需求分析不够深入和详尽,将会在 …
基于 Docker 怎么部署 GitLab 环境 2024-04-03 109 部署GitLab环境基于Docker涉及到的关键步骤包括:准备Docker环境、选择合适的GitLab Docker镜像、配置运行参数、创建并运行GitLab容器、验证GitLab部署成功。在这些步骤 …
gitlab怎么备份仓库中的数据 2024-04-03 337 GitLab备份仓库中的数据至关重要,可以通过以下几种方式进行:手动备份、配置自动备份脚本、使用GitLab提供的备份工具、镜像仓库到其他服务器。 其中,使用GitLab提供的备份工具是一种常见且高效 …